Tropical Cyclone Bulletin No. 13
SEVERE TROPICAL STORM “KRISTINE”
Issued at 5:00 pm | 23 October 2024
“KRISTINE” HAS INTENSIFIED INTO A SEVERE TROPICAL STORM
LOCATION: 175 km East of Echague, Isabela (16.5 °N, 123.3 °E)
PRESENT MOVEMENT: Moving Westward at 20 km/h
STRENGTH: Maximum sustained winds of 95 km/h near the center and gustiness of up to 115 km/h
TROPICAL CYCLONE WIND SIGNAL #2
(Potential Threats: Minor to Moderate threat to life and property)
Quezon including Polillo Islands
KRISTINE is forecast to move generally northwestward for the next 12 hours before turning generally westward for the rest of the forecast period. It is forecast to make landfall over Isabela tonight or tomorrow (24 October) early morning. It will then cross the mountainous terrain of Northern Luzon and emerge over the waters west of Ilocos Region tomorrow morning.
KRISTINE may exit the Philippine Area of Responsibility (PAR) region on Friday (25 October).
KRISTINE is forecast to further intensify until it makes landfall. Slight weakening will occur while crossing Northern Luzon. Re-intensification may occur over the West Philippine Sea.
